integrated building controls refer to the combination of various building systems – such as heating, ventilation, air conditioning, lighting, and security – into a single, centralized control system. This allows for seamless communication between different systems, enabling them to work together in harmony to optimize building performance.
One of the key benefits of integrated building controls is increased energy efficiency. By monitoring and adjusting various systems based on real-time data and occupancy patterns, building operators can significantly reduce energy waste and lower utility costs. For example, the system can automatically adjust heating and cooling settings based on the number of occupants in a room, or dim lights in unoccupied areas to save energy. This level of automation not only saves money but also helps reduce the building’s environmental footprint.
Another advantage of integrated building controls is improved occupant comfort and productivity. With a centralized control system, building operators can easily customize settings to meet the unique needs of different spaces and occupants. For example, they can adjust temperature, lighting, and air quality levels to create a comfortable and productive work environment. Studies have shown that comfortable and well-lit spaces can have a positive impact on employee morale, productivity, and overall well-being.
In addition to energy efficiency and occupant comfort, integrated building controls also enhance building security and safety. By integrating access control, video surveillance, and alarm systems into a single platform, building operators can easily monitor and manage all aspects of building security in real-time. For example, they can receive alerts about unauthorized access or suspicious activities and take immediate action to mitigate risks. In the event of an emergency, the system can also initiate predefined response protocols to ensure the safety of occupants.
Furthermore, integrated building controls provide valuable insights into building performance and usage patterns. By collecting and analyzing data from various systems, operators can identify trends, patterns, and anomalies that can help them make informed decisions about maintenance, upgrades, and improvements. For example, they can track energy consumption, equipment performance, and occupant behavior to identify areas for optimization and cost savings. This data-driven approach enables proactive maintenance and continuous improvement, leading to better overall building performance.
